Use the instr function with -0 as the start point and look for the second occurance of the space.

"Dave" <dchou1108_at_hotmail.com> wrote in message news:8f19196e.0209290611.38cc9b2_at_posting.google.com...
> I am trying to get the city name from an address column of type
VARCHAR2(80)
>
> The address looks as follow:
> ADDRESS
> --------------------------------------------------------------------------



> 2800 Montrose Ave. Lacresenta, CA 92832
> 1231 Fullerton Ave. Fullerton, CA 92898
> 3301 Huston Ave. Garden Grove, CA 92123
> 1234 Placentia Rd. Placentia, CA 92871
> 34 Starbucks Rd. Seattle, WA 43249
> 1214 Ford Ave. LA, CA 98649
> 1317 Bond Ave. LA, CA 98649
>
> How do I get the city for the substring. I am trying to group my query by
the city.
>
> Thanks
